Frequently Asked Questions:
Q: How long can I wear Bausch & Lomb Lacelle Premium Contact Lens?
A: These lenses are designed for daily wear and can typically be worn for up to 8-10 hours a day. It is essential to follow the recommended wearing schedule provided by your eye care practitioner.

Q: Can I sleep while wearing Bausch & Lomb Lacelle Premium Contact Lens?
A: It is not recommended to sleep with these lenses as it can increase the risk of eye infections and complications. Always remove the lenses before sleeping unless specifically advised otherwise by your eye care professional.

Q: Are Bausch & Lomb Lacelle Premium Contact Lens suitable for people with sensitive eyes?
A: These lenses are crafted to provide comfort and clarity for a wide range of users, including those with sensitive eyes. However, if you experience persistent discomfort or redness, discontinue use and seek advice from your eye care specialist.

Q: How should I store Bausch & Lomb Lacelle Premium Contact Lens when not in use?
A: Ensure that the lenses are stored in a clean and sterile contact lens case with solution recommended by your eye care professional. Always wash and dry your hands thoroughly before handling the lenses to prevent contamination.
